My passion for occupational therapy started at a young age. I knew I wanted to find a job in healthcare where I could help others, develop relationships with people, and also get to show my creative/ fun side. Occupational therapy does all that! It’s truly such an amazing career that focuses on helping people achieve, maintain, or regain meaningful skills so that they can be the most independent and functional in their daily lives.

I started my occupational therapy career after graduating from the University of Mary in 2018. I then accepted a job working at Trinity Health in Minot, where I served in their outpatient therapy department working primarily with kids while also filling in their acute care and inpatient rehab facilities. I then transitioned to Kids in Motion in Mandan, where I deepened my care and skills in the areas of autism, ADHD, oppositional defiant disorder, anxiety disorders, developmental delays, picky eating, and sensory processing disorders. Although I have primarily specialized in pediatrics, I began to miss seeing patients across the lifespan and am very interested in joining Focus to enhance my skills working with various diagnoses and post operative patients within the geriatric population!
